Ogun Police Confirm TikToker Mirabel in ICU as Sexual Assault Probe Continues

The Ogun State Police Command has confirmed that a TikTok content creator identified as Mirabel is currently receiving treatment in an intensive care unit (ICU) as investigations continue into her allegations of sexual assault.

The Command’s Public Relations Officer, Oluseyi Babaseyi, disclosed this on Thursday during an appearance on The Morning Brief.

According to the police, contact was established with the content creator earlier in the week after videos she posted detailing the allegations went viral online.

Babaseyi explained that officers initially traced her to the Ibafo area before confirming that the reported incident allegedly occurred in Ogijo, a border community between Ogun and Lagos states.

“When the Divisional Police Officer in Ibafo met with her, she was taken to the hospital for medical evaluation. She was not in a stable condition at the time, but investigations are ongoing,” he said.

He added that Mirabel is currently in intensive care and that her medical condition remains the priority.

“As we speak, she is in the ICU receiving appropriate care. Her health is paramount. Once she stabilises, investigators will obtain further details necessary for the case,” he stated.

The case has sparked widespread debate on social media, with some users questioning the authenticity of her claims. However, the police urged the public to refrain from drawing conclusions while investigations are ongoing.

“We advise against emotional reactions or premature judgments. Our findings will be based strictly on evidence,” Babaseyi said, encouraging anyone with relevant information to come forward.

He also clarified that Mirabel was not arrested, dismissing online claims suggesting otherwise.

“She reported a case to the police. She was not arrested. We are treating her as a complainant while we investigate,” he said.

The police noted that certain individuals have been invited for questioning but declined to provide further details to avoid compromising the investigation.

Mirabel’s allegations gained public attention after videos she posted on Sunday went viral, in which she claimed an intruder forced entry into her residence, assaulted her and inflicted injuries.

Following the online outcry, including advocacy under the #StopRapingWomen campaign, the Lagos State Domestic and Sexual Violence Agency initially engaged the matter before jurisdiction shifted to Ogun State, where the alleged incident reportedly occurred.

Police say further updates will be provided as the investigation progresses.
